What is Talc: Read this before you reach out
Talcum powder that many Americans use comes from talc. Magnesium, oxygen, and silicon comprise the major elements of this mineral. Some forms of natural talc contain asbestos. This substance can cause lung cancer because of inhalation. As a result, companies have been manufacturing asbestos-free talcum products since the 1970s. Talc originates from rock deposits mined…

Triclosan: Is it safe to use?
Majority of manufacturers add triclosan to a variety of consumer products. As an anti-fungal and anti-bacterial agent, it helps prevent or reduce bacterial or microbial contamination. Triclosan is present in some body wash and anti-bacterial soaps, toothpastes, and cosmetic items. The United States Food and Drug Administration (FDA) regulates such products. Over the counter drugs…

Shanti Mantra
This Shanti mantra “Sahanavavatu mantra” is one of the shaanti (peace) mantras which has its origins in the Taittiriya Upanisad. This mantra is often used as a “universal” prayer, to send the message of peace and prosperity.
